Classification: Query Message Board URL: http://boards.ancestry.com/mbexec/msg/rw/UNB.2ACI/1056.1 Message Board Post: Hi Beverly, Samuel is listed in the Tombstone Inscriptions of Pulaski County as being buried in the Joiner Cemetery. It says Samuel G. W. Hiatte, Jul 1835 - after 1900. Either that is what it says on the stone or the person that was reading and writing down what it said, was not able to read the last two numbers. Samuel's wife's stone is incomplete as well. It says, Elizabeth Hiatte, 19 Jun 1844 - ?? Jan ????, it also has "wife of S. C. W. As bad a shape as the stone is probably in, the "C" was probably a G. Joiner Cemetery is near Crocker, MO, which is in Pulaski County. It is off the road in someone's field. It is all the way across the county from where I live.
